A NEW website from Dartmoor Accommodation promises to be an invaluable resource for Dartmoor National Park and the surrounding area, offering 200-plus holiday properties and event listings along with suggestions of what to see and do.

Acquired last year by Lisa Jenkins and Julian Tarrant-Boyce from Mary Tavy, DartmoorAccommodation.co.uk was founded 17 years ago by Jill Pendleton of Chagford and was one of the first local websites to include personal reviews of the properties visited.

 Features of the new mobile-friendly website, designed by Clare Associates, include a new eye-catching logo and guest blog posts from the likes of Olympic Silver medallist Heather Fell. The site also incorporates shots of stunning Dartmoor scenery captured by local photographers, Mark George and Portia Crossley, giving browsers plenty of inspiration and reasons to visit.

 The relaunched site has been designed to aid accommodation providers in promoting their property. Members can now log in and edit their listing and add photos as well as events and offers and links to their social media pages.
